When it comes to beauty, there are few things women find more important than safe and effective hair removal. While there are plenty of options for getting rid of unwanted body hair, not many provide long-term results like laser hair removal. This technique uses a pulse of laser light to destroy the part of the hair follicle where new growth occurs so the hair does not grow back in the treated area. DIY Kits

Do you prefer a do it yourself approach? There are several new at home DIY laser hair removal kits if you would rather not deal with a clinic and don't mind spending a little money. Most of these home lasers range in price from around $450 to as much as $700.

If you are only needing to get rid of hair in a small area such as your upper lip, brow, or underarms; it is typically more economical to just visit a local clinic and have your service performed by a trained professional. Remember that while you can do a lot of beauty routines at home, sometimes you are better off taking advantage of a trained, experienced, and certified professional technician. On the other hand, if you have several areas to remove hair from; a home hair removal device may end up saving you money in the long run. Remember that it takes several sessions to see permanent results.
